    My mom entered the facility fully able to do all of her ADL's. 5 months later she was confined to a wheelchair, unable to do even one ADL on her own, and eventually ended up in the hospital, nearly comatose because Heartfields decided to increase a medication (without consent) that has very dangerous side effects, including death. When my mom protested having her pants and Depends yanked down by over worked care givers, the executive director asked me if her behavior was due to prior sexual abuse! Like most human beings, she doesn't like her clothes removed without consent. Maryland doesn't require the caregivers (the front line staff that will predominantly be caring for your loved ones) to have skilled training/certification and they are allowed to care for up to 18 residents at a time. Heartfields confirms they are assigned 16-18 residents per shift, they don't have time before they have to move "on to the next one". Therapy tries to provide guidance, but it falls on deaf ears. The caregivers also do housekeeping in addition to caring for your family members, and unfortunately, many are just physically unable to do this demanding type of work. I could go on about how they refused to meet with me for 4+ months about the $8k+ overcharges they erroneously charged, or how they continued to ignore our requests to remove feces covered wastebasket in my mother's bathroom for weeks, or how the staff stuffed my mother's clothing into a full size trashcan, despite having clothes hamper and a laundry basket.We reached out to the executive director, regional director, and filed a formal complaint. We were told an internal investigation would take place. A month later, and still no one followed up even after reaching out for status update. Leadership doesn't seem to care. Finally, when we moved my mom out yesterday, we were shocked and saddened to learn 4 residents died last week. 4 out of approximately 30 residents, that's 13% of their population!
